Jack L. Osborn, 75, of Sedalia, died on Wednesday, January 16, 2013 at Bothwell Regional Health Center. He was born in Cameron, Missouri on April 26, 1937, the son of Earl and Doris (Rainey) Osborn. Jack and Sherri Harrison were united in marriage on August 22, 1978. Sherri survives of the home.   Jack enlisted in the U.S. Army in 1958. He served 3 years, some of which was in Germany during the Berlin Wall beginning, before his Honorable Discharge at the rank of Staff Sergeant. He received a Certificate of Achievement and attended the Army's NCO Academy.   Jack worked in the banking industry for over 31 years. The last 23 were with Third National Bank, where he most enjoyed his position and the customers he served. Jack loved the outdoors. He enjoyed hunting and fishing as time allowed. Jack was actively involved throughout the Sedalia and Pettis County community. He was on the boards of the Pettis County Selective Service Board, the Sedalia/Pettis County Development Corp. and Pettis County Crime Stoppers. He was also a member of Sedalia Rotary Club, Sedalia Lodge #236 A.F and A.M., Sedalia Shrine Club, Smith Cotton High School PTA, Sedalia Council of the Arts, Sacred Heart School Foundation, Sedalia Rod and Gun Club, Elk's Lodge, Moose Lodge and the Sedalia Country Club.   In addition to his wife, Sherri, Jack is survived by his son, Christopher K.
